What to know about ZIP 52166

ZIP code 52166 covers St. Lucas, IA in Fayette County with a population of about 172.

At a glance, the area shows median age of 33.3 versus a U.S. median of about 38.9.

It sits in telephone area code 563; U.S. House district IA-2; the CEDAR RAPIDS - WTRLO - IWC&DUB media market.

Income and economy in St. Lucas, IA

Median household income in ZIP 52166 is about $74,375 — about even with the U.S. median ($75,149).

On socioeconomic markers, US5 shows a poverty rate of 8.1%; unemployment rate near 0.0%; 16.3% of adults with a bachelor’s degree or higher (about 17.4 points below the national share (33.7%)).

Labor and commute patterns include leading industry context around Manufacturing, Healthcare, and Construction; about 9.3% of workers reporting work-from-home (about 5.9 points below the U.S. share (15.2%)); a mean commute of about 78.0 minutes (U.S. average near 26.8).

Housing and affordability in ZIP 52166

Median home value is about $115,000 — about 67% below the U.S. median home value ($348,079).

Housing tenure and rents show owner-occupancy near 98.4% (about 33.0 points above the national owner-occupancy rate (65.4%)).
